Output e40f6188688a5edd4b348eb14e470063cd2a4f498c2e8b5122366ac0957625c6:0

value
486876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8517ef4f833d45a368d2aa16985c25b987c8f288 OP_EQUAL
address
3DpkU5QRh5uJM3R6HoKHxkQf7rquvkujj6
transaction
e40f6188688a5edd4b348eb14e470063cd2a4f498c2e8b5122366ac0957625c6
spent
true